Ingredients

  • Blue cheese (crumbled, high-quality)
  • Heavy cream
  • Unsalted butter
  • Garlic (finely minced)
  • Shallot or onion (optional, finely minced)
  • Sour cream or crème fraîche
  • Lemon juice or white wine vinegar
  • Salt
  • Black pepper
  • Fresh herbs (parsley or chives, optional)

Instructions

  1. Melt butter in a saucepan over medium-low heat until foamy but not browned.
  2. Add minced garlic and shallot; sauté gently until soft and fragrant.
  3. Pour in he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er, stirring constantly.
  4. Reduce heat to low and add blue cheese crumbles gradually.
  5. Stir until partially melted, keeping some texture.
  6. Add sour cream and lemon juice for balance.
  7. Season with salt and black pepper to taste.
  8. Simmer for 3–5 minutes until thick and silky.
  9. Remove from heat and let rest briefly before serving.

Flavor Variations

  • Steakhouse Style: Add cracked pepper and Worcestershire sauce
  • Wing Sauce: Thin with milk and add extra acidity
  • Pasta Sauce: Add parmesan and extra cream
  • Burger Sauce: Chill and fold in mayonnaise

Storage & Reheating

  • Refrigerate up to 4 days in airtight container
  • Reheat gently over low heat, stirring frequently
  • Add splash of cream if needed

Ingredients
  

Sauce Base
  • 2 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 1 tsp garlic minced
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 0.75 cup blue cheese crumbled
  • 0.25 cup sour cream
  • 1 tsp lemon juice
  • salt to taste
  • black pepper to taste

Equipment

  • Saucepan
  • Wooden spoon
  • Whisk

Method
 

  1. Melt butter in a saucepan over medium-low heat.
  2. Add garlic and sauté gently until fragrant.
  3. Pour in he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er.
  4. Add blue cheese gradually, stirring until partially melted.
  5. Stir in sour cream and lemon juice.
  6. Season with salt and black pepper to taste.
  7. Simmer briefly until thickened, then remove from heat.

Notes

Serve warm for steaks or chilled as a dip. Adjust thickness with cream or milk as needed.
